TICKET-218: Expired credentials for narration fetch

Plugin authors: the Murmurstone audio-guide app stopped pulling exhibit narrations because the token for our internal Trackhall service expired. Plugins calling the narration endpoint will see 401s until you swap in the rotated credential. The replacement key for Trackhall is provided below.

app token of kawif-yafop = zpat2_88

Careful review for the Quillgate CSV import wizard before we cut the release. The chunked parser now backpressures correctly, and I verified the encoding sniffer against malformed fixtures from the Harwick dataset. One concern: the retry ceiling interacts with the preview row cap, so both must ship together. The constants we settled on during testing are as follows.

tuning table, yajog-yahof:
BUDGETS = {
    "lamvan": 303,
    "wenox": 460,
    "fenvan": 525,
}

Nightbatch coordinates nightly data backfills across three environments: dev, staging, and production. Dev runs backfills hourly for faster iteration; staging mirrors production's midnight window but against sampled data. Production backfills start at 00:30 local and must finish before the 05:00 reporting freeze. For the weekly sync: note that retry policies differ per environment, which explains last week's divergent failure counts. Each environment's scheduler instance is deployed with the following configuration values.

settings of tagef-bawif:
DRUIX_HOST=druix.zemvarlabs.internal
DRUIX_PORT=8000

Runbook: Tilebarrow prefetcher stall. Symptom: map tiles render blank past zoom 14 on the Corvane staging ring. Check the prefetcher queue depth first; over 50k means the fetch workers died. Restart via the orchestrator, not systemd, or the dedupe cache desyncs. Confirm recovery by watching hit-rate climb past 90% within five minutes. The orchestrator's admin endpoint requires the internal credential shown below.

gateway credential: qvz2-6w